A company's stock was selling at $28 a share. A month later it was selling at $21 a share. What is the percent loss?

Respuesta :

Hrishii
Hrishii Hrishii
  • 02-01-2021

Answer:

25%

Step-by-step explanation:

[tex]percentage \: loss \\ \\ = \frac{28 - 21}{28} \times 100 \\ \\ = \frac{7}{28} \times 100 \\ \\ = \frac{1}{4} \times 100 \\ \\ = 25\% [/tex]
